MPX4080D - Integrated Silicon Pressure Sensor

Features

  • 3.0% Maximum Error over 0° to 85°C.
  • Ideally suited for Microprocessor or Microcontroller-Based Systems.
  • Temperature Compensated from -40° to 105°C.
  • Easy-to-Use, Durable Epoxy Unibody Package Pressure MPX4080D Rev 4, 1/2009 MPX4080D Series 0 to 80 kPa (0 to 11.6 psi) 0.6 to 4.9 V Output Device Name Package Options MPX4080D Tray Case No. 867 None.

Freescale Semiconductor + Integrated Silicon Pressure Sensor On-Chip Signal Conditioned, Temperature Compensated and Calibrated The MPX4080D series piezoresistive transducer is a state-of-the-art monolithic silicon pressure sensor designed for a wide range of applications, but particularly those employing a microcontroller or microprocessor with A/D inputs. This patented, single element transducer combines advanced micromachining techniques, thin-film metallization, and bipolar processing to provide an accurate, high level analog output signal that is proportional to the applied pressure.
